Art. 51 Course documentation

Any person who provides training must issue participants with written documents containing the material learned.

Art. 51a Online teaching

1 The theory part of training may be taught in its entirety via an online teaching platform, provided the participants can be clearly identified. 2 Teaching by other electronic means, in particular by video conference, may account for a maximum of one quarter of the theory part of training.

Art. 52 Training management

The learning outcome is evaluated and documented after the theoretical part has been completed.

Art. 53 Practical exercises during training

Practical exercises during training are performed under supervision by carrying out the day-to-day work in an animal housing facility. No procedures may be carried out on animals purely for training purposes unless that procedure has been approved as an animal experiment in accordance with Article 141 AniWO.

Art. 54 Evidence of training or of a course

The confirmation that provides evidence of training in accordance with Article 197 AniWO or of a course in accordance with Article 198 paragraph 2 AniWO must contain at least the following information: a. the logo or stamp with the name and address of the organiser; b. the surname, first name, date of birth, place or country of origin and place of residence of the person who has completed the course; c. the place and date of training and title of training; d. the place, date, name and signature of the person responsible for the training.

Art. 55 Evidence of a traineeship

The confirmation that provides evidence of a traineeship in accordance with Article 198 paragraph 2 AniWO must contain at least the following information: a. the name, address, training and practical experience of the person responsible for looking after the trainee; b. the details of the stock and form of use of the animal housing facility; c. the surname, first name, date of birth, place or country of origin and place of residence of the trainee; d. the duration, scope and nature of the activities performed by the trainee; e. the place, date, name and signature of the facility manager.

Art. 56 Official confirmation of long-standing experience

The authorities shall confirm the long-standing experience in accordance with Article 193 paragraph 3 AniWO of a person in handling a type of animal by providing the following information: a. the surname, first name, date of birth, place or country of origin and place of residence of the person; b. information about the stock, form of use, length of time for which the animal housing facility has existed and the person responsible for caring for the animals; c. the place, date, stamp, name and signature of the person authorised by the competent authority for this purpose.

Art. 57 Confirmation of continuing education

Confirmation of participation in continuing education must contain at least the following information: a. the organiser; b. the title and duration of the continuing education, with the place in which it was carried out and the date; c. the name of the participant.
